My first day at ARCC was full of nervousness and new experiences. My first day was last year at the start of the spring semester. I was 16 years old and I was just starting my first semester as a PSEO student. I was homeschooled all my life prior to attending ARCC, so I was probably more nervous than normal. I wasn't sure what to expect, but I knew it was going to be different than anything I had ever done before.
I arrived a few minutes early just in case I had trouble finding my classes, but I wasn't quite expecting it to take as long as it did. I kept getting mixed up about the room numbers so I ended up walking into class a few minutes late. I didn't know anyone; I felt kind of out of place at first.
The first thing we did in all my classes was as a class we went over the syllabus. To be honest, the syllabus slightly scared me because it seemed to make all my classes sound really hard. I felt a little uncomfortable during my entire first day, but I suppose it was only because I was so nervous. As my first couple weeks went by I gradually was able to get into the flow of things and my nervousness seemed to diminish more and more.
